Questions
IPv4 Subnet Calculator FAQ
What does a CIDR prefix mean?
The prefix is the number of leading network bits. For example, /24 leaves 8 bits for 256 total IPv4 addresses.
Are network and broadcast addresses usable?
Traditional subnets reserve the first address as network and the last as broadcast. Point-to-point /31 and single-host /32 networks use special rules.
